站群服务器绑定域名:5步完成批量部署与SEO优化

👤 admin 📂 技术交流 👁️ 4 💬 0 🕐 2026-05-22 23:27
头像
admin
这家伙很懒,什么都没写~

在运营站群时,域名绑定是基础操作,但也是许多新手容易出错的关键环节。错误地绑定域名不仅会导致网站无法访问,还可能影响搜索引擎的抓取与排名。本文将详细拆解站群服务器绑定域名的完整流程,从IP分配、DNS解析到Nginx配置,并提供批量操作的实用技巧,帮助你在多站点管理中提升效率与SEO效果。

一、准备阶段:IP资源与域名规划

在开始绑定前,你需要确认站群服务器已分配足够的独立IP。每个域名最好对应一个独立IP,这能避免因同IP下其他站点受罚而牵连自身。同时,建议将域名按主题或行业分组,方便后续管理。

具体操作步骤:

  • 登录服务器控制面板,获取IP列表(如:192.168.1.10 - 192.168.1.20)。
  • 在域名注册商处,为每个域名添加A记录,指向对应的独立IP。例如:example1.com -> 192.168.1.10
  • 等待DNS生效(通常需要10分钟到2小时),使用ping example1.com验证解析是否成功。

二、Web服务器配置:以Nginx为例绑定域名

Nginx因其高性能和低资源占用,是站群服务器的首选。以下是绑定域名的标准配置,以example1.com为例:

server {
    listen 80;
    server_name example1.com www.example1.com;
    root /var/www/example1;
    index index.html index.php;
    
    location / {
        try_files $uri $uri/ =404;
    }
}

关键点说明:

  • server_name:务必同时包含带www和不带www的域名,避免搜索引擎认为存在重复内容。
  • root:每个域名的网站文件应存放在独立目录,便于后期维护和权限隔离。
  • 保存配置文件后,执行nginx -t测试语法,再执行systemctl reload nginx重载配置。

三、批量绑定:使用脚本提升效率

当站点数量超过10个时,手动编辑配置文件容易出错。以下是一个简单的Bash脚本,可根据域名列表批量生成Nginx配置:

#!/bin/bash
DOMAINS=("example1.com" "example2.com" "example3.com")
for domain in "${DOMAINS[@]}"; do
    cat > /etc/nginx/sites-available/$domain.conf < /var/www/$domain/index.html
done

执行脚本后,运行nginx -t && systemctl reload nginx即可完成批量绑定。此方法可减少人为输入错误,同时保证每个站点的根目录独立。

四、SSL证书部署:提升站群SEO权重

Google已明确将HTTPS作为排名信号之一。因此,在站群服务器绑定域名后,应立即为每个域名安装SSL证书。推荐使用Certbot工具进行自动化部署:

sudo apt install certbot python3-certbot-nginx
sudo certbot --nginx -d example1.com -d www.example1.com

对于批量域名,可以编写循环脚本,逐一向Certbot提交申请。注意:同一IP下申请多个免费证书时,需控制频率(建议每5分钟最多申请10个),避免被Let's Encrypt限制。

五、绑定后的SEO验证与常见错误排查

完成站群服务器绑定域名后,务必进行以下验证:

  • 访问测试:在浏览器输入域名,确认能正常打开对应网站文件。
  • 搜索引擎验证:使用Google Search Console添加域名,检查是否有抓取错误。
  • 日志检查:查看Nginx访问日志(/var/log/nginx/access.log),确认请求均指向正确站点。

常见错误及解决方案:

  • DNS未生效:使用dig example1.com查看解析记录,若未同步,等待或更换DNS服务商。
  • 403 Forbidden:通常为根目录权限问题,执行chmod 755 /var/www/example1并设置所有者chown www-data:www-data
  • SSL证书不匹配:检查证书是否绑定到正确的域名,使用certbot certificates查看列表。

站群服务器绑定域名是一项需要细心与规划的工作。通过合理的IP分配、Nginx配置脚本化以及SSL自动化部署,你不仅能节省大量时间,还能确保每个站点都符合搜索引擎的收录标准。记住,稳定的绑定是站群SEO成功的第一步。如果你在操作中遇到其他问题,欢迎在评论区留言交流。

💬 回复 0
💭

暂无回复

登录后回复